Quick 300 Minutes to Hours Conversion (min to hr) - Convert Whiz

Web300 Minutes x 0.016666666666667 = 5 Hours. 300 Minutes is equivalent to 5 Hours. How to convert from Minutes to Hours. http://www.gardenaction.co.uk/plantfinder/ceanothus-california-lilac_2.asp WebUsually ignored by deer, this pretty shrub is prized by birds, butterflies and hummingbirds. A fast grower, this spectacular shrub is extremely drought tolerant once established. A great California Lilac selection for coastal gardens. Grows up to 4-6 ft. tall (120-180 cm) and 9-12 ft. wide (270-360 cm). Thrives in average, well-drained soils in ...

Web11 de abr. de 2024 · The best time to prune ceanothus trees is after they flower but be careful not to overprune. Use small gardening shears or scissors, which should be strong enough to cut through the ends of branches.
